Duties & Responsibilities

  • Perform a wide range of general building maintenance duties as assigned.
  • Maintain familiarity with building systems including but not limited to ERV/HRV units, HVAC units, water heating units, water cooling system, fire alarm system, electrical systems, exhaust timers.
  • Maintains outside property maintenance including snow removal, pool area, equipment room and always ensure safe environments.
  • Mechanical room housekeeping
  • General inroom repairs, filter changes, water softener top ups, painting, high dusting of events facility venting
  • Exterior building maintenance including, exterior light bulbs changed as required.
  • Perform repairs and upgrades as needed.
  • Opening and closing the pool & maintain pool chemistry.
  • Use all equipment according to operating procedures and notify Facility Manager of any issues.
  • Follow preventative maintenance programs as directed.
  • Reactive maintenance support
  • Follow all Pearle Hospitality and Health & Safety policies and procedures.
  • Interact with team members, guests, business partners, and contractors in a professional manner.
  • Interact with external contractors and report back any information required to Facility Manager.
